PerformancesJudith Roddy Biography
For the National Theatre: Translations, The Plough and the Stars, The Silver TassieOn Broadway: A Particle of Dread
Other theatre includes: Danse, Morob, Knives in Hens, All That Fall, A Doll's House, The Seagull, The Rehearsal, Playing the Dane, A Particle of Dread (Oedipus Variations), Sam Shepard Short Stories, Conversations on a Homecoming, A Whistle in the Dark, Days of Wine and Roses, Blackbird, Big Love, The Dandy Dolls Trilogy, The Wolf of Winter, The Wild Duck, The Wonderful World of Dissocia, Skyroad, Cruel and Tender, Further than the Furthest Thing, Juno and the Paycock, The Constant Wife, Twelfth Night, Drama at Inish, A Doll's House, My Children My Africa
Judith Roddy is a member of Field Day Company.

After a sold-out run, Ian Rickson's acclaimed production of Translations returns to the NT in October 2019. Brian Friel's modern classic is a powerful account of nationhood, which sees the turbulent relationship between England and Ireland play out in one quiet community. Dermot Crowley, Ciarán Hinds, Seamus O'Hara, Judith Roddy, and Rufus Wright return to reprise their roles, with Jack Bardoe, Liádan Dunlea, Fra Fee, Amy Molloy and Julian Moore-Cook joining the cast. Previews from 15 October, press night 21 October final performance 18 December.

Signature Theatre and Field Day present the U.S. Premiere of A PARTICLE OF DREAD (OEDIPUS VARIATIONS) bySam Shepard, directed by Nancy Meckler. The production runs now through December 21, 2014 with a November 23 opening night in The Alice Griffin Jewel Box Theatre at The Pershing Square Signature Center (480 West 42nd Street between 9th and 10th Avenues).
